Intel unveils Core i3-560, Pentium E6800 and Celeron E3500

Today Intel updated price list with 3 new budget and mid-performance desktop models - Core i3-560, Pentium E6800 and Celeron E3500. Intel also added to the price list Pentium E5700, Atom N550 and Xeon W3670 microprocessors that were released earlier this month. In addition to this, price of Core i7-950 microprocessor was slashed by 48%, from $562 to $294, and the price of Xeon W3550 was reduced from $387 to $294.

Built on 32nm Westmere microarchitecture, Core i3-560 incorporates two cores with HyperThreading technology, memory controller with DDR3-1333 MHz memory support, and graphics controller operating at 733 MHz. With 3.33 GHz core frequency, the i3-560 is 133 MHz faster than current top Core i3 model with processor number i3-550. Other CPU features of the i3-560 are 4 MB L3 cache, 73 Watt TDP, and 1156-land LGA package, which fits socket 1156 motherboards. Official Intel price for this processor is $138. Support for this model was already added to ASRock, ASUS, Biostar and MSI motherboards.

Dual-core Celeron E3500 and Pentium E6800 CPUs are socket 775 microprocessors built on older 45nm Core micro-architecture. The Celeron E3500 runs at 2.7 GHz, uses 800 MHz Front Side Bus frequency, and has 1 MB level 2 cache. The Pentium E6800 has 3.33 GHz core frequency, 1066 MHz FSB and 2 MB L2 cache. The E3500 and E6800 processors are priced at $52 and $86 respectively. Celeron E3500 and Pentium E6800 can be already pre-ordered in some online stores. Support for the microprocessors was added to MSI and ASUS (Pentium E6800 only) motherboards.
